 +=====Leviathan Deck=====
 +Every Leviathan card is one use, and is then discarded.\\
 +Card breakdown-
 +  * 40% movement
 +  * 20% items
 +  * 20% entrance
 +  * 10% magic powers
 +  * 10% bad cards
